| package org.apache.cloudstack.storage.snapshot; |
| |
| import java.util.ArrayList; |
| import java.util.LinkedHashMap; |
| import java.util.List; |
| import java.util.Map; |
| |
| import com.cloud.storage.VolumeDetailVO; |
| import com.cloud.storage.dao.VolumeDetailsDao; |
| import com.cloud.utils.exception.CloudRuntimeException; |
| import org.apache.cloudstack.engine.subsystem.api.storage.DataStore; |
| import org.apache.cloudstack.engine.subsystem.api.storage.SnapshotDataFactory; |
| import org.apache.cloudstack.engine.subsystem.api.storage.SnapshotInfo; |
| import org.apache.cloudstack.engine.subsystem.api.storage.SnapshotService; |
| import org.junit.Assert; |
| import org.junit.Before; |
| import org.junit.Test; |
| import org.junit.runner.RunWith; |
| import org.mockito.InjectMocks; |
| import org.mockito.Mock; |
| import org.mockito.Mockito; |
| import org.mockito.junit.MockitoJUnitRunner; |
| |
| import com.cloud.storage.DataStoreRole; |
| import com.cloud.storage.Snapshot; |
| import com.cloud.storage.SnapshotVO; |
| import com.cloud.storage.dao.SnapshotDao; |
| import com.cloud.utils.fsm.NoTransitionException; |
| |
| @RunWith(MockitoJUnitRunner.class) |
| public class DefaultSnapshotStrategyTest { |
| |
| @InjectMocks |
| DefaultSnapshotStrategy defaultSnapshotStrategySpy = Mockito.spy(DefaultSnapshotStrategy.class); |
| |
| @Mock |
| SnapshotDataFactory snapshotDataFactoryMock; |
| |
| @Mock |
| SnapshotInfo snapshotInfo1Mock, snapshotInfo2Mock; |
| |
| @Mock |
| SnapshotObject snapshotObjectMock; |
| |
| @Mock |
| SnapshotDao snapshotDaoMock; |
| |
| @Mock |
| SnapshotVO snapshotVoMock; |
| |
| @Mock |
| DataStore dataStoreMock; |
| |
| @Mock |
| VolumeDetailsDao volumeDetailsDaoMock; |
| |
| @Mock |
| SnapshotService snapshotServiceMock; |
| |
| Map<String, SnapshotInfo> mapStringSnapshotInfoInstance = new LinkedHashMap<>(); |
| |
| @Before |
| public void setup() { |
| mapStringSnapshotInfoInstance.put("secondary storage", snapshotInfo1Mock); |
| mapStringSnapshotInfoInstance.put("primary storage", snapshotInfo1Mock); |
| } |
| |
| @Test |
| public void validateRetrieveSnapshotEntries() { |
| Long snapshotId = 1l; |
| Mockito.doReturn(snapshotInfo1Mock, snapshotInfo2Mock).when(snapshotDataFactoryMock).getSnapshot(Mockito.anyLong(), Mockito.any(DataStoreRole.class), Mockito.anyBoolean()); |
| Map<String, SnapshotInfo> result = defaultSnapshotStrategySpy.retrieveSnapshotEntries(snapshotId); |
| |
| Mockito.verify(snapshotDataFactoryMock).getSnapshot(snapshotId, DataStoreRole.Image, false); |
| Mockito.verify(snapshotDataFactoryMock).getSnapshot(snapshotId, DataStoreRole.Primary, false); |
| |
| Assert.assertTrue(result.containsKey("secondary storage")); |
| Assert.assertTrue(result.containsKey("primary storage")); |
| Assert.assertEquals(snapshotInfo1Mock, result.get("secondary storage")); |
| Assert.assertEquals(snapshotInfo2Mock, result.get("primary storage")); |
| } |
| |
| @Test |
| public void validateUpdateSnapshotToDestroyed() { |
| Mockito.doReturn(true).when(snapshotDaoMock).update(Mockito.anyLong(), Mockito.any()); |
| defaultSnapshotStrategySpy.updateSnapshotToDestroyed(snapshotVoMock); |
| |
| Mockito.verify(snapshotVoMock).setState(Snapshot.State.Destroyed); |
| } |
| |
| @Test |
| public void validateDestroySnapshotEntriesAndFilesFailToDeleteReturnsFalse() { |
| Mockito.doReturn(false).when(defaultSnapshotStrategySpy).deleteSnapshotInfos(Mockito.any()); |
| Assert.assertFalse(defaultSnapshotStrategySpy.destroySnapshotEntriesAndFiles(snapshotVoMock)); |
| } |
| |
| @Test |
| public void validateDestroySnapshotEntriesAndFilesDeletesSuccessfullyReturnsTrue() { |
| Mockito.doReturn(true).when(defaultSnapshotStrategySpy).deleteSnapshotInfos(Mockito.any()); |
| Assert.assertTrue(defaultSnapshotStrategySpy.destroySnapshotEntriesAndFiles(snapshotVoMock)); |
| } |
| |
| @Test |
| public void validateDeleteSnapshotInfosFailToDeleteReturnsFalse() { |
| Mockito.doReturn(mapStringSnapshotInfoInstance).when(defaultSnapshotStrategySpy).retrieveSnapshotEntries(Mockito.anyLong()); |
| Mockito.doReturn(false).when(defaultSnapshotStrategySpy).deleteSnapshotInfo(Mockito.any(), Mockito.anyString(), Mockito.any()); |
| Assert.assertFalse(defaultSnapshotStrategySpy.deleteSnapshotInfos(snapshotVoMock)); |
| } |
| |
| @Test |
| public void validateDeleteSnapshotInfosDeletesSuccessfullyReturnsTrue() { |
| Mockito.doReturn(mapStringSnapshotInfoInstance).when(defaultSnapshotStrategySpy).retrieveSnapshotEntries(Mockito.anyLong()); |
| Mockito.doReturn(true).when(defaultSnapshotStrategySpy).deleteSnapshotInfo(Mockito.any(), Mockito.anyString(), Mockito.any()); |
| Assert.assertTrue(defaultSnapshotStrategySpy.deleteSnapshotInfos(snapshotVoMock)); |
| } |
